There are two types of creators on TikTok: creators with large followings on other platforms that are trying the latest new thing, and unknown, new creators that are finding an audience within TikTok first. Gen Z is redefining "sports" as we know it, evidenced by 52% of young males spending more time watching trick shot and dice-stacking videos than traditional sports content. Millennials are known for cutting the cord—in other words, ditching cable for online streaming services—but Gen Z was never connected to the cord to begin with. Vloggers have also played a large role in Gen Z’s brand and product discovery, since this generation sees endorsements by influencers as more trustworthy and authentic than ones by celebrities and sports stars. According to YPulse’s most recent media consumption monitor survey, while Millennials still name TV as the screen they watch the most media content on weekly, smartphone is the top screen for Gen Z.
